In the introduction to Heron's Pneumatics a number of theoretical subjects are discussed which form the theoretical background of the functioning of the devices. One of these subjects is the demonstration of the corporeity of air, which is closely related to the clepsydra. The devices presented in the work are paradigms or applications of the propositions found in the introduction. In this paper we will present devices that either provide the observational/experimental evidence for demonstrating air's corporeity or constitute direct applications of the principles of the functioning of the clepsydra. We will ascertain the degree to which Heron understood the relevant subjects and his ability to utilize the devices in technical applications.
